Market Yard in Pune to Remain Closed on Independence Day

Pune, 11th August 2023: In observance of India’s 77th Independence Day, Pune’s Market Yard situated at Gultekdi will remain closed on Monday, August 15. This announcement of closure was made by the Agriculture Produce Market Committee (APMC) speaker.

The closure will extend beyond the main wholesale market at Market Yard. Sub-markets located in Moshi, Manjari, Uttam Nagar, and Khadki will also be shut on the same day. Additionally, various sections within the Market Yard complex, including fruits and vegetables, the banana market, cattle market, jaggery and food grain sections, estate operations, storage facilities, printing and stationary services, weighing centers, the petrol pump, floriculture, betel nut trade, soil-water testing, and the FDA laboratory, will remain non-operational.

Farmers are strongly advised not to bring their produce to the Market Yard on this day. Traders, agents, and all stakeholders are requested to take note of this temporary arrangement and plan their activities accordingly.
